TCA9535:低功耗16位I2C/SMBus IO扩展器

需积分: 10 4 下载量 159 浏览量 更新于2024-06-27 4 收藏 3.06MB PDF 举报
"TI-TCA9535.pdf - I/O扩展器" TI的TCA9535是一款低电压、16位I2C和SMBus(System Management Bus)低功耗输入/输出(I/O)扩展器,带有中断输出和配置寄存器。这款器件主要用于扩展微处理器或控制器的I/O能力,使其能够连接更多的外围设备,如LED、键盘或其他传感器。 主要特点: 1. I2C到并行端口扩展器:TCA9535通过I2C总线接口与主控制器进行通信,可以扩展出多个并行I/O口。 2. 宽电源电压范围:支持1.65V至5V的工作电压,这使得该芯片能够在多种电源环境下正常工作。 3. 低待机电流消耗:在不活动时,TCA9535能保持较低的电流消耗,有利于节能设计。 4. 开漏、主动低电平中断输出:INT引脚是一个开漏输出,当满足特定条件时,由低电平触发中断请求。 5. 5V容限I/O端口:所有输入和输出引脚都可承受5V电压,增强了与其他逻辑电平设备的兼容性。 6. 400kHz快速I2C总线:支持高速I2C通信,提高系统响应速度。 7. 极性反转寄存器:允许用户反转输出引脚的极性,适应不同的应用需求。 8. 3个硬件地址引脚:通过A0、A1和A2三个引脚的不同组合,最多可以连接8个TCA9535设备,而不会发生地址冲突。 9. 锁存输出和高电流驱动能力:输出端口具有锁存功能,并且能直接驱动高电流负载,如LED或小型继电器。 TCA9535的应用场景包括但不限于: - 智能家居和物联网设备:扩展控制器的GPIO端口,连接各种传感器、开关和指示灯。 - 工业自动化:在分布式系统中,用于远程控制和监测各种设备状态。 - 便携式设备:在电池供电的产品中,通过低功耗特性延长电池寿命。 - 用户界面:驱动按键阵列、LED显示等交互部件。 该器件还包括一个重置(RESET)和使能(EN)控制输入,用于控制整个I/O扩展器的状态。中断输出(INT)可以用来通知主控制器有新的事件发生,比如外部设备的状态改变。此外,每个I/O端口都有独立的配置寄存器,可以灵活设置端口的方向(输入/输出)和状态。 在实际应用中,开发者需要遵循数据手册中的指导进行电路设计,确保正确连接SDA(串行数据线)和SCL(串行时钟线),以及地址引脚A0、A1和A2。同时,为了安全使用,应留意数据手册末尾的重要通知,了解产品可用性、保修、安全关键应用的使用、知识产权问题以及其他免责声明。